Employers "still" pay fees in exchange for public contracts

The secretary general of the Catalan employers said to have fallen but laments that "there are those who want to earn a living"

David Garrofé, CECOT secretary general, said in an interview on 3/24 political parties still require public commissions in exchange for concessions.

Garrofé, asked whether employers will continue to demand commission said that "much less any employer says we still see some strange practice that."
